Can't connect to multiple devices

I have a fourth-gen Airport Extreme which was working perfectly fine until yesterday, when I attempted to extend the network using an old Express. At one point, I accidentally selected the Extreme as the network extender and it went haywire. Since then, I have factory reset it three times, called my ISP, tried every other trick in the book, but it still says it can't get an IP or DNS address and I can't get internet through it on more than one device at a time. For example, my iMac is working perfectly on my wifi but while I can access the Airport Utility on my network via my iPhone, Safari just spins forever and can't load anything. Additionally, my other peripherals can't get internet either -- including my Apple TV, which also connects to the network but cannot connect to Netflix, etc.


is my Extreme busted? HELP!

Never mind. I fixed it. I downgraded the firmware several generations, did yet another factory restart, and then upgraded the firmware back to the latest ... and now it's working. Go figure.
